How to Get Help with your Plants the easy way!

We can help you find the answers to your questions easier and the

RIGHT answer if you will do this:

When asking a question state the

grow type.....and answer these questions:

1. Soil or Hydro ???

Hydro

~ state what System

type of Water used ~THIS IS IMPORTANT!

~For Both types of grows

~ House water ~ Reverse Osmosis ~ or Distilled

PH & PPM’S, and water Temps (especailly important in Hydro)

Soil grows

~ state what soil is used and additives to the soil

2.Temps & Humidity

3. Lights ~ HID (MH or HPS) or cfl’s or T-5’s etc.

4. Ventilation System {fresh air}{CO2}

5. Nutrients used ~ Brands and amount used.

6. Indoor or Outdoor Grow

7. Pixs ~ if you can post they always help us see what it is,

*****(Good link to help you post pics~
Resizing your photos with power toys)


Resizing Your Photos with PowerToys.. ******


8. Strain if they know~ Indica ~ Sativa ~ Bagseed???


9. How old the plant is.

10. Seed or Clone? Sexed? Feminized?

HELP!!! well all 6 of my bagseed plants have died. I used organic soil 5 parts to 1 part wormcastings, reverse osmosis water, eight 54 watt t-5 lights, 18 hrs on 6 hrs off, PH was at a constant 7, fan circulating the air, its a closet set up but the door always stay's open and fresh air from a nearby window as well, temp 70-80 & i dont believe i over watered them.
It started with the 2 bottom leaves ram horning and then turning yellow, so i cutt them off, then the next 2 leaves up did the same, i dont get it, they were only like 3 wks old
